1755, the American colonies. While the English and French fight for control of the North American continent, the American Indians fight for their lives. Another war rages, however, within the hearts of one Seneca warrior and a white woman in danger . . .

Indentured servant Sarah Strong has met with more than her share of troubles en route to New Hampshire with her young charge. She's been set upon by war parties, and tossed about by river rapids, only to fall over a mountain-high waterfall. And the dangers keep coming...

A reclusive Seneca Indian, White Thunder has only one purpose in life: to find and kill the man who murdered his beloved wife. But when he stumbles across the injured, desperate Sarah, White Thunder finds what could turn out to be a new purpose.

Now, if the pair can only put aside their many differences, they might find what they've been looking for all along . . .
